SILVES, Portugal - University of Portland junior All-American Stephanie Lopez continued her impressive international play by helping the U.S. Women’s National Team to a 2-1 victory over China in the opening match of the 2007 Algarve Cup. Lopez started in the midfield and assisted on the game-winning goal. With the match tied at 1-1, Lopez ran onto a ball and nutmegged her defender towards goal She toe-poked a pass back to Lloyd who side-stepped a defender to the inside and cracked a right footed shot from just left of the penalty arc, plowing the ball into the net at the upper left corner from 25 yards out. The halftime score held as the USA racked up a 15-4 shot advantage and held on for the 2-1 victory. The USA came out in a 3-4-3 formation with Cat Whitehill sweeping behind markers Christie Rampone and Tina Ellertson, with Stephanie Lopez and Lori Chalupny deployed on the flanks. Up front, the USA started with Abby Wambach and Lilly, who were playing in their first matches of 2007, alongside Heather O’Reilly. The first U.S. goal came in the 19th minute as Abby Wambach drew a penalty kick. USA veteran Kristine Lilly stepped up and hammered her spot kick into the right corner. China answered back almost immediately, tying the game on a free kick taken by Liu Sa. Han Duan got the slightest touch to the ball, re-directing her seven yard header low inside the far post. The USA will next face Finland, a 3-0 loser to Sweden in the other Group B match, at Ferreiras on Friday. Kickoff for that match is 4:15 PM local / 11:15 AM ET.
